**Handover — address autocomplete widget (Larkspool checkout)**

Heads up for the release: the widget is feature-complete, just waiting on the debounce fix to land. Known quirks — it over-suggests rural routes and the keyboard nav stutters on long lists; both are ticketed, neither blocks. Feature flag stays off until QA signs the regression pass. After Thursday I'm out, so route any release questions to the person named below.

approver of yawig-yajef = Briius Jorix

**Handover — Timetable Solver (Chalkline)**

On-call: the Chalkline solver for Brindlemoor Academy is mid-rerun after last night's constraint change (no double periods after lunch). If it stalls past 30 minutes, kill the worker and restart from checkpoint 12 — don't restart from scratch, that takes four hours.

The checkpoint store is locked; to reopen it, enter the recovery passphrase below.

vault phrase of fahog-yajof = istael-zorwyn

Key Ceremony Checklist — Item 7: Branwick Queue Compaction Hold

Before rotating ceremony keys, pause log compaction on the Branwick message queue. Compaction during rotation can purge unacknowledged key-escrow segments. Steps: set compaction.hold=true on brokers 1–3, confirm lag under 500 msgs, snapshot the offsets ledger. Resume compaction only after the new keys are sealed. Support handles the unseal step; to open the escrow shard you will enter the passphrase printed below.

unlock words, tawif-tahop: oliys-ulawyn-tamdor-lamys-casox-jormir-fraius-kasath-ulador-ulamir-holir-sorys-holeth

## Formula sandbox tuning

User-supplied formulas in Gridmoor execute inside a restricted interpreter with hard ceilings on time, memory, and call depth. Reviewers should confirm any change to these ceilings is justified in the PR description, since raising them widens the abuse surface. Defaults were chosen from production traces. The current limits are as follows.

limits module of tafog-fawip:
WEIGHTS = {
    "julix": 57,
    "lamys": 992,
    "kasvan": 209,
    "quenok": 750,
    "alddor": 259,
    "oliath": 1009,
    "wenix": 815,
}